What is NAD IV Therapy?
NAD IV therapy involves the intravenous infusion of nicotinamide adenine dinucleotide (NAD+), a coenzyme found in every cell of the body. It plays a critical role in cellular metabolism and energy production. By administering NAD+ directly into the bloodstream, this therapy aims to enhance the body’s natural functions, which can support recovery, boost energy levels, and even improve cognitive function. In recent years, NAD IV therapy has gained attention as a potential solution for various health concerns, including chronic fatigue, addiction, and neurodegenerative disorders.
How Does NAD IV Therapy Work?
The process of NAD IV therapy begins with a thorough consultation where a healthcare provider assesses the patient’s medical history and current health status. Upon determining candidacy for the therapy, the procedure can commence. The treatment typically lasts between several hours, during which the patient receives a controlled infusion of NAD+. As the NAD+ enters the bloodstream, it easily penetrates the cellular membranes and begins to restore cellular function. This infusion mechanism allows for a faster and more efficient absorption compared to oral supplements, sidestepping digestive absorption barriers.

Cost Considerations for NAD IV Therapy
Average Pricing for NAD IV Therapy Near Me
The cost of NAD IV therapy can vary significantly based on location, provider reputation, and session length. Typically, individual sessions may range from $300 to $600, depending on these factors. It’s advisable to inquire about pricing during your consultation to understand what to expect financially.
Insurance and Payment Options
Not all insurance plans cover NAD IV therapy as it is often considered a complementary treatment. It is important to check with your insurance provider to see if any aspects of the treatment may be reimbursable. Many clinics also offer payment plans or financing options to help manage the costs.
